Teen charged over taxi assault
A SPEEDWELL teenager has been charged in connection with an attack on a taxi driver in South Bristol.
Avon & Somerset Police said a group of teenagers arrived in Choke Walk, Brislington, on May 21 by taxi and went to a nearby home, where an altercation broke out.

A resident then chased the group back to the taxi and during subsequent violence the taxi driver, a man in his 50s, was wounded.
He was treated in hospital and later discharged.
Police said the 17-year-old from Speedwell, who cannot be named for legal reasons, has been charged with affray and criminal damage.
A 16-year-old has been charged with affray, criminal damage and possession of an offensive weapon.
Another boy of 17 and a 16-year-old girl have been released on police bail.
